Ripple reported $2,395.6 million in circulating RLUSD as of September 3, 2026, a figure commonly rounded to $2.4 billion. The disclosure records outstanding supply on that date but does not establish when circulation first crossed the threshold. DeFiLlama later showed roughly 2.42 billion RLUSD in circulation on September 12, with about 1.37 billion on Ethereum and 1.05 billion on the XRP Ledger. On September 11, Ripple minted 10 million RLUSD on the XRP Ledger, whose circulating balance was listed at $1,053,014,745. The issuance followed uneven September activity: $143.1 million was minted and $7.2 million burned on September 1; on September 10, no RLUSD was minted on either network, while $1.5 million was burned on the XRP Ledger and $15 million on Ethereum. Ripple separately reported $2,517.7 million in reserve funds as of September 3. RLUSD is designed to maintain a one-dollar value, backed by segregated cash and cash-equivalent reserves and redeemable 1:1 for dollars. Its expansion also includes Uniswap V4 trading activity, Clearpool’s planned move from Ethereum to the XRP Ledger, and an institutional credit fund with Cicada Partners that will use RLUSD exclusively for settlements and payouts. Circulation, market capitalization and trading volume measure different aspects of the asset and should not be treated as interchangeable.
